Definition jail in American English

jail noun

[countable/uncountable] noun
/dʒeɪl/
1

a place where people are put after they have been arrested, or where people go as punishment for a crime

Example

the county jail

Example

Adam spent 3 years in jail for drug possession.

Example

She's been sent to jail for murder.

Example

He was stealing again, two months after getting out of jail.
